The Economic Diffusion Radius of High-Speed Railway Stations

Fangzhi Liang, Zhenye Yao, Danqin Yang and Hanwen Xu

Finance Research Letters, 2023, vol. 55, issue PB

Abstract: We explore the economic diffusion radius of high-speed railway (HSR) stations. Using spatial differences-in-differences (DID) method, we find that the openings of HSR stations can promote companies’ performance within 20 kms. We also observe a heterogeneity of the effect in different administrative divisions, with a positive impact on surrounding companies in the same city as the nearest station (the "Diffusion Effect"), and a negative impact on companies in neighboring city (the "Backwash Effect"). Our paper helps policy makers better utilize the infrastructure of HSR. Furthermore, the spatial DID method offers a new perspective to address endogeneity in HSR studies.
